As a multimarker-aholic I was thrilled to hear you could make them from composite meshes in 1.5. I decided to experiment and document my results.
It appears you can make Multimarkers now out of composite meshed objects as well as skinned objects. It doesn't appear you can skin a Multimarker Object without first turning it into a composite mesh though.
I'm not sure about the result using ZCut; I thought it would work. These are just my experiments playing with multimarkers, and there may be different steps you can take to get different results.

Tami, have I got a question for you, you Multimarker a holic. I am trying to create some butterfly wings. I create the first wing by drawing on the canvas, capturing the alpha, and making a 3d object from it. Here's your part. Clear the canvas, then I draw the first wing on the canvas using the new 3d tool, multimark, snapshot, postition until, they look like wings on a butterfly, multimark, then draw the multimarked object on the canvas. When I do this, the wings are both facing the same direction. I will try to get a picture up soon to demonstrate fully, but do you have any initial ideas about what I am missing? TIA! :confused:

DMerchan, the only thing I can think of right off hand is if you're using the deformation, mirror function on the snapshotted wing. That would cause the wing to flip the opposite direction and in 1.23 (haven't tested 1.5) it would cause the first wing to change flip as well unless you save both under different names. DMerchan, what I do when doing that is before doing the mirror deformation, I press the "clone" button. Then you place the mirrored object on your canvas and place a marker for it. That way, you have two separate objects, one the mirror of the other.
